Tata Power surges after Delhi CM Arvind Kejriwal quits

Tata Power Company is currently trading at Rs. 77.25, up by 3.40 points or 4.60 % from its previous closing of Rs. 73.85 on the BSE.

The scrip opened at Rs 74.40 and has touched a high and low of Rs 77.60 and Rs 74.40 respectively. So far 417424 shares were traded on the counter.

The BSE group 'A' stock of face value Re 1 has touched a 52 week high of Rs 102.45 on 15-Mar-2013 and a 52 week low of Rs. 68.25 on 06-Aug-2013.

Last one week high and low of the scrip stood at Rs 76.75 and Rs. 73.00 respectively. The current market cap of the company is Rs. 18391.31 crore.

The promoters holding in the company stood at 32.47% while Institutions and Non-Institutions held 48.56% and 15.78% respectively.

Tata power’s stock rose after activist-turned-politician Arvind Kejriwal resigned as chief minister of Delhi on Friday, frustrated by obstacles put in the way of an anti-corruption bill. Kejriwal was appointed in part on a promise of lowering electricity tariffs for millions of Delhi's voters and in December had asked the state auditor to look into the accounts of power distribution companies to see if they were profiteering. In respect of this Delhi government had asked the region's power regulator to revoke the licences of two electricity distributors if they fail to supply power, drawing criticism from the companies.
